A United States data item description (DID) is a completed document defining the data deliverables required of a United States Department of Defense contractor. [1] A DID specifically defines the data content, format, and intended use of the data with a primary objective of achieving standardization objectives by the U.S. Department of Defense.

This test plan was initially defined in MIL-HDBK-1553, Appendix A. It was updated in MIL-HDBK-1553A, Section 100. The test plan is maintained by the SAE AS-1A Avionic Networks Subcommittee as AS4111. The RT Production Test Plan is a simplified subset of the validation test plan and is intended for production testing of Remote Terminals.
MIL-STD-105 was a United States defense standard that provided procedures and tables for sampling by attributes based on Walter A. Shewhart, Harry Romig, and Harold F. Dodge sampling inspection theories and mathematical formulas. Widely adopted outside of military procurement applications.
Handbooks of failure rate data for various components are available from government and commercial sources. MIL-HDBK-217F, Reliability Prediction of Electronic Equipment, is a military standard that provides failure rate data for many military electronic components.
